Norm--as others have said, research what your other options are first, before you accept that routing. Since they changed your flight so significantly, you can CANCEL and get all your money back. Therefore you have a lot of leverage with AA. If you can find something else that would work better for you, even on a different day, call AA and ask to be switched. Or, if you can find something that works better for you on another airline, at a price you can live with, call and cancel. Don't accept that routing unless you literally have no other choice. ...Edited to add, just noticed you have a travel agent. They should have been the FIRST one to suggest that you don't accept that routing, but see what you can do to get a different flight. If they didn't explore that possibility, I think you should look for a different travel agent.
